Output bf75b2f8063f7a2a0bbe066d43902159d613d82e84cd8dd0e8c331fe66b1f719:25

value
52071
script pubkey
OP_0 OP_PUSHBYTES_20 c70b5e704f1492486753d8cd69d2e85d94fcb5fa
address
bc1qcu94uuz0zjfyse6nmrxkn5hgtk20ed06h324pa
transaction
bf75b2f8063f7a2a0bbe066d43902159d613d82e84cd8dd0e8c331fe66b1f719
confirmations
7063
spent
true